Mijn uitwerkingen van de Assessments van het tweede semester Object Oriented Programming with Java (Java Programming II) van de van de Universiteit van Helsinki, faculteit Computer Sciences.
Al mijn geschreven code zit per opdracht in /main/java. Sommige Assignments waren uitgebreid, en sommigen beknopt. De focus van hun curriculum ligt op het zo goed mogelijk aanleren van Core Java aan startende developers. De verschillende disciplines vanuit de basis onder de knie krijgen. In de volgende map zitten dan ook 68 verschillende assignments. Sommige Assignments waren uitgebreid, en sommigen beknopt.
Onderwerpen die in de assignments terugkomen zijn o.a. Lists, Maps, streams, exception handling, Generics, lambda's, JavaFX, file processing, event handling en andere belangrijke Interfaces en classes als Iterator, Comparable, Sets, Random, Comparator etc.
In /test/java bevindt zich alle testcode (JUnit). Het doel hiervan is om alle Assignments gemaakt door de studenten te testen op een correcte werking. Dit betekent dus dat dit coded is door de Universiteit van Helsinki, en niet door mij zelf :)